'It can't continue like this': Paramedics exasperated by long ambulance waits in northeast Wales
Anna Taylor, a paramedic in northeast Wales, tells Paste BN that ambulance teams can spend whole 12-hour shifts waiting with patients because of busy hospitals. "I worry that if one of my family or friends needed an ambulance, I know that we would struggle to get one to them," she adds.
